We are going to be skipping the alcohol packages so that we don't have to keep up just to break even.. We would have to drink 7x $6 beers a day for 7 days just to break even on the Select package.. but I do like the changes they've made for 2014 (new packages/no longer does everyone in a cabin need to purchase it).. I used to really enjoy the drink package to try all the unique beers, but it's gotten to the point where they exclude so many of them now.
